Output 8059fcf3ae42f122a7776f0ba33e9f9fd502c3c6911f7664f8449464939cd5df:2

value
596820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ce0f5cf6cc58bc4f59d726907e163cb5813ca4e9 OP_EQUAL
address
3LUZXWZmxwbrR8QvMTXPzF9BbWwd1KEQTg
transaction
8059fcf3ae42f122a7776f0ba33e9f9fd502c3c6911f7664f8449464939cd5df
spent
true